HBase in Action
HBase in Action

HBase is a NoSQL storage system designed for fast, random access to large volumes of data. It runs on commodity hardware and scales smoothly from modest datasets to billions of rows and millions of columns. HBase in Action is an experience-driven guide that shows you how to design, build, and run applications using HBase. First, it introduces you to the fundamentals of handling big data. Then, you'll explore HBase with the help of real applications and code samples and with just enough theory to back up the practical techniques. You'll take advantage of the MapReduce processing framework and benefit from seeing HBase best practices in action. ...

TCP/IP Architecture, Design and Implementation in Linux
TCP/IP Architecture, Design and Implementation in Linux

This book provides thorough knowledge of Linux TCP/IP stack and kernel framework for its network stack, including complete knowledge of design and implementation. Starting with simple client-server socket programs and progressing to complex design and implementation of TCP/IP protocol in linux, this book provides different aspects of socket programming and major TCP/IP related algorithms. In addition, the text features netfilter hook framework, a complete explanation of routing sub-system, IP QOS implementation, and Network Soft IRQ. This book further contains elements on TCP state machine implementation,TCP timer implementation on Linux, TCP memory management on Linux, and debugging TCP/IP stack using lcrash. ...
